Transaction 989015a403883b9644ba9d606575008305bf2aa6272a2ef19be6ec0d5b8dcbc7
1 Input
2 Outputs
- 989015a403883b9644ba9d606575008305bf2aa6272a2ef19be6ec0d5b8dcbc7:0
- 989015a403883b9644ba9d606575008305bf2aa6272a2ef19be6ec0d5b8dcbc7:1
value 270326
address 16n6JrqUFncE7PT17zVV2uRghthPJLFtUX
value 845897
address 12QhFjuWyRYDSjkLPSKFGY5aqAJY8SPgpP